17th January 2003: Capital Classic Grand Prix - 800m - Newtown Park, Wellington

1st Gareth Hyett 1:49.17 Ariki
2nd Nick Hudson 1:49.34 AUS
3rd Mark Rodgers 1:49.50 Port
4th Rees Buck 1:50.69 Scottish
5th Tom Osbourne 1:50.72 Bays
6th Shane Rohde 1:52.46 Bays
7th Tim Prendergast 1:53.90 Scottish
8th Damien Shirley 1:59.3 Counties
DNF Josh Martin Pacemaker

It was perfect racing conditions in Wellington for this 800m. Josh Martin, one of NZ's top 400m runners was set to take the pace through the first lap. I had been told that he was going through 400m in 53 seconds which is quite a bit ahead of what I was aiming for. At the start of the race I got out well but by 150m I had dropped back to eighth and was struggling. Things then settled down and I moved into seventh on the home straight just before the end of the first lap. The leaders went through 400m in approximately 54 seconds, just a little down on expected, but just slow enough for me to be on the back and come through in 55.5 seconds. With 300m to go I made a surge and passed three guys before slowing with 200m to go and being passed back by one of them. I was slowing down a bit in the final 150m but managed to pick up a place on the line and finish in fourth place. I was very happy with this race as I ran a lot faster than expected and also because it shows room for more improvements. Unfortunately, I may not get to run another 800m race until Europe this year.
